TAMILNADU MAGNESITE LIMITED (TANMAG) a wholly owned Govt. of TamilNadu Undertaking was formed on 17th January,1979 under the Companies Act, 1956 to optimise Mining and Processing of rare mineral - "MAGNESITE" by improving the quality to international standards.
MAGNESITE AND ITS USES:
Magnesite is a Carbonate of Magnesium (MgC03). Raw Magnesite as such is not used in any industry except in Chemical Industry for the manufacture of Sulphates (Epsam Salt). A Small quantity of pure magnesite free from Iron is used in the glass industry. Magnesite after dead-burning is an ideal Mineral for manufacture of Super Duty Basic Refractory Bricks largely used in the Steel Industry. Lightly Calcined Magnesite (LCM) containing 2-10 per cent CO2 called Caustic Magnesite is used for a wide variety of indutsrial application, the most important being in the manufacture of Oxychloride or Sorel Cement, Pulp and Paper processing chemicals, Rayon and in production of Fertiliser and Animal Feed Stuffs. Specially prepared light magnesium carbonate is added to Rubber for reinforcing and stiffening. It is also used in the manufacture of Magnesium Metals. The grinding stones for rice husk milling is made from emery Caustic-Calcined Magnesia and Magnesium Chloride.
In addition to above Magnesite is considered to be potential for use in Uranium processing, Water treatment and stack gas scrubbing etc.
ROLE OF TANMAG
Over the last two decades ' TANMAG ' has grown to be a synonym for magnesite the value mineral which is the backbone of many Iron Industry where high temperature operation is involved.
The Magnesite Reserves of Salem are famous world over for the crypto crystaline structure and are best suited for refractory bricks production.
TANMAG - MINES DIVISION
The Mines presently operated by TANMAG are known as "ARASU MAGNESITE MINES" and are located in the north-eastern portion of the Magnesite bearing area of the Chalk-Hills. These deposits are located at the foot of the famous Yercaud Hills and are accessible by the Salem - Yercaud Road. The mining area is spread over 578 acres. TANMAG do not sell Raw Magnesite to outsiders, as the entire mined minerals are used in TANMAG itself for manufacturing Dead Burnt Magnesite and Calcined Magnesite.
TANMAG ROTARY KILN DIVISION
The 100 TPD Rotary Kiln to produce Dead Burnt Magnesite was commissioned during December 1985. T he installed capacity is 30,000 tonne per annum of various grades of Dead Burnt Magnesite. The Raw Magnesite is sintered in Rotary Kiln at a high temperature of 1, 750 c ensuring proper crystal growth/ periclause formation with best suited Lime / Silica ratio. Dead Burnt Magnesite finds application in Refractory Industry for manufacture of Basic Refractory Bricks and manufacture of Ramming Mass, fettling Materials and Magnesite Mortar. The major customers of TANMAG for DBM are available in the State of (i) Bihar (ii) Maharastra, (iii ) Andhra Pradesh, (iv ) Orissa, (v) West Bengal and ( vi) Madhya Pradesh.
TANMAG - SHAFT KILN DIVISION
The Shaft Kiln Division has five numbers of vertical Shaft Kilns for the manufacture of Caustic Calcined Magnesite which is also known as Lightly Calcined Magnesite. The installed capacity for Calcined Magnesite is 19,500 Tons per annum. Raw Magnesite is calcined in Shaft Kilns using Furnace Oil as fuel at a temperature in the range of 1,000c to 1,100c to produce Chemically reactive grade known as Caustic Calcined Magnesite.
This is used for extremely wide range of end uses covering
i |
Oxychloride Flooring |
ii |
Sorel cement for binding abrasives (Grinding Wheel Industry) |
iii |
Rayon manufactures, Magnesium Chemicals, Light Basic Magnesium Carbonate |
iv |
Animal Feeds |
v |
Ceramics, Paper, Glass, Electrical Insulation |
vi |
Boiler Lagging etc. |
The major customers of TANMAG for Calcined Magnesite are available in the State of West Bengal, Bihar, Rajasthan, Madhya Pradesh and Maharastra.
EXPORT
TANMAG was a leading Exporter of Caustic Calcined Magnesite to countries like United Kingdom, Holland, Japan, Australia, West Germany and New Zealand and a valuable foreign exchange earner upto 1996-97. Subsequently, due to cheaper prices and liberal credit offered in the international market, the export of Calcined Magnesite has come down drastically and TANMAG is able to export only a minimum quantity of 100 MT per annum to Japan.
POWERS AT DIFFERENT LEVELS
In general the affairs of the company are being controlled by the Board of Directors mainly consisting of Government Nominees. The Special Secretary , Industries Department, Government of Tamilnadu is the Chairman of the Board and Directors are nominated from various Government Departments. The day today affairs and major decisions are taken by the Managing Director, who is normally an I.A.S Officer and exclusively deputed to TANMAG by the Government of Tamilnadu.
Sufficient administrative and business related powers have been delegated to MD to run the company efficiently.
Apart from the Registered Office, where the Managing Director's Office is located, there are other Divisions called (i) Mines Division, (ii ) Shaft Kiln Division and (iii)Rotary Kiln Division. For the convenience of the functioning of the company Mines Manager, Factory Manager(SKD) and Factory Manager (RKD) are looking after the administrative functions of the above Divisions respectively under the control and guidance of the Managing Director. Thus there are proper distribution of powers at different levels and the delegation of power is made in such a way that helps to maintain the smooth functioning of the company.
REQUIREMENTS FOR THE GRANT OF LICENCE
As far as Licenses are concerned, TANMAG has to get clearance from various Departments. The renewal of Mining Lease, Factories Licenses, etc. are to be obtained from Government after expiry of the stipulated period. In order to obtain the above License the Company has to adopt certain procedures and certain basic requirements to be satisfied for the grant/renewal of License as detailed below:-
PROCEDURE TO BE ADOPTED FOR THE RENEWAL OF MINING LEASE
For non-forest lands ( Patta, Poramboke, etc.) the Mining Lease application with required details is to be submitted to the State Government through District Collector/Director of Geology and Mining.
In respect of lands classified under Reserve Forest category, the Proforma proposals for obtaining clearance under Section 2 of the Forest Conservation Act (1980), it is to be submitted to District Forest Officer. After inspection of the area by the DFO, the proposal (with his specific recommendations) will be forwarded to Conservator of Forest - Nodal Officer (CCF, FC Act) - PCCP and State Government (Department of Environment and Forest) and will be sent to Government of India, (Inspector General of Forest).
Government of India will direct the Regional Chief Conservator of Forests of the respective regions to inspect the area and forward the proposal with recommendation. Upon receiving the same from RCCF, the Government of India will agree and communicate the clearance under FC Act to the State Government and Lease will be granted by State Government (Department of Environment and Forest).
